Talks
- "Dog fouling, parking violations, anti social behaviour - more interesting than ultra smart sensors???"
- Open data is
- available raw
- in modifiable form
- redistributable
- can be re-used
- anyone can access
- is free
- "We have to be aware that the data scientists at the hack day can analyse the info freely to come up with patterns, scenarios or conclusions outside of our control"
- Future Cities Catapult is funded by Technology Strategy Board - organiser of this event
- Catapult's main role sounds like it is neutral, matching projects to funding and grants, finding spaces, cleaning up data, making datasets available, etc
- NEUL - paul egan - "do machines dream of their own network?" - machine-2-machine communication, frictionless IoT / NaaS Network as a Service / Sensor deployment
- in 2013 the OeD has added IoT into the dictionary.
- Internet of Things: "A proposed development of the internet in which everyday objects have network connectivity, allowing them to send and receive data."
